Understanding Testosterone Propionate

Testosterone propionate quickly acts and serves both healing and performance needs. This testosterone form releases fast into the blood. Thus, it's favored by bodybuilders and athletes. They use it to boost muscle size and get its anabolic advantages.

What is Testosterone Propionate?

Testosterone propionate is a special type of testosterone. It has a propionate ester that speeds up its release. Unlike other esters like enanthate or cypionate, it works faster. After injection, peak levels in the blood are reached in 24 to 48 hours. This means users can adjust doses quickly.

Benefits of Testosterone Propionate

Testosterone propionate offers big gains in muscle size, stronger strength, and quicker recovery times. It's highly valued in sports and bodybuilding circles. Usually, doses for better performance are 100 to 200 mg every other day. This helps keep testosterone levels even for best results.

How Testosterone Propionate Works

Testosterone propionate attaches to androgen receptors in the body. This starts processes that help build muscles, burn fat, and boost overall performance. However, it can lower the body's own testosterone production. This might lead to smaller testicles and less sperm. People with a history of prostate or breast cancer should stay away from it, due to its risks.

Testosterone Propionate Cycle

The testosterone propionate cycle is favored by athletes and bodybuilders for better performance and gains. It's vital to know how much to take, depending on your experience, to get the best out of it while staying safe. Here we cover beginner, intermediate, and advanced dosage plans.

Beginner Cycle

Beginners should start with a smaller dose to see how their body reacts. Most new users take 50 to 100 mg every other day. This method lets first-timers track their body’s reaction without too much stress. For those doing an 8-week cycle, here's a basic plan:

  • Weeks 1-8: Testosterone propionate 50-100 mg every other day
  • Optional: Add aromatase inhibitors to control estrogen-related side effects

Intermediate and Advanced Cycles

More experienced people can handle bigger doses. Those in the middle range take 100 to 200 mg every other day. For the advanced, doses over 200 mg with additional steroids can boost outcomes. Here’s an example for both levels:

Cycle Type Dosage Duration
Intermediate 100-200 mg every other day 8-10 weeks
Advanced 200 mg+ every other day 10-12 weeks

Stacking with Other Compounds

Combining testosterone propionate with other steroids can push your results further. Popular choices are Nandrolone, Anadrol, and Growth Hormone (HGH). For those looking to bulk up, consider this combo:

  • Testosterone propionate: 200 mg every other day
  • Nandrolone: 400 mg weekly
  • Anadrol: 50 mg daily

Using this mix can help grow muscles, shed fat, and recover quicker. Success depends on tracking side effects and adjusting doses to fit your health and fitness aims.

FAQ

What is the typical dosage of testosterone propionate for bodybuilding?

A typical testosterone propionate dosage for bodybuilding is 50 mg to 100 mg every other day. Users should gauge their tolerance and goals. Consulting a healthcare professional for advice is crucial.

How long should a testosterone propionate cycle last?

A testosterone propionate cycle usually goes on for 8 to 12 weeks. This schedule helps users see muscle gains while keeping side effects low.

What are some common side effects of testosterone propionate?

Some usual side effects include acne, hair loss, mood swings, and more aggression. Watching these effects and planning a post-cycle therapy (PCT) to restore balance is vital.

Can testosterone propionate be stacked with other steroids?

Yes, it can be stacked with steroids like nandrolone or trenbolone to boost results. However, it's key to watch dosages and cycle lengths to stay safe.

Is testosterone propionate suitable for beginners?

It's good for beginners because it acts fast and doesn't stay in the system long. Newbies should start with a small dose to see how they react.

What is the difference between testosterone propionate and other testosterone esters?

The main difference is in the ester size, which changes how quickly it enters the blood. Testosterone propionate has a short half-life, needing more frequent injections than longer esters like testosterone enanthate or cypionate.
